Herpetologists do use “snake traps” of sorts, but they generally work only if you actually see the snake. (They also work with lizards, but on the same principle.) Get some paper towel tubes and cap them at one end. Array the capped tubes near a place where the snake would normally go when threatened. If you chase the snake toward its hiding place, it may dash for one of the tubes as an obvious shelter, but it might have a hard time turning around once inside. Like I said, this only works if you actually see the snake; it also won’t work with very small snakes or with very large ones; the former can easily turn around and escape, and the latter won’t fit at all.
